I was direct hire by my employer, He wanted me to be in Canada ASAP. He contacted an agency to assist my application. They agency from Canada said that my visa applicatioen will be applied in Ukraine but process in Canada because there are few applicants in there. So now my employer is offshore for work. Tjey said the papers are approved so they need to send it to me. But my employer did not pay for the courier fee because they dont have idea how much it would cost. Now I have to send 480 dollars to Ukraine Agency so they can send all the docs like LMIA, contract, application letter and the check on my name for my ticket and medical and some other docs.Now the employer wants me to send 480 dollars and said he will reimburse me the 480 once he arrive in Russia from work. Now is it possible to apply the visa in Ukraine the process will he in Canada? I am a little confuse. Please help me or I will just find another employer because I dont have 480 dollars in my pocket now.

It is clear case of scam. Please do not pay. contact CIC for further details.
